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Traffic and criminal matters in Chullora, NSW can involve court proceedings, particularly when charges are contested or enforcement action becomes necessary. Court attendance may be required depending on several factors, including the nature of the offence, your response to charges, the prosecution's position, and whether any disputes arise during the legal process. Based on your location in Chullora, NSW, one nearby court location is: Burwood Court House 7 Belmore Street, Burwood This location is provided for general context only. Traffic and criminal matters are generally handled in the Local Court, with more serious offences progressing to the District Court.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Criminal & Traffic lawyers cost in Chullora, NSW?
Criminal & Traffic lawyers in Chullora, NSW generally charge between $280 and $550 per hour, with rates varying based on the lawyer's experience, location and firm size. Total costs depend on how much time your matter requires. Straightforward cases, such as basic legal advice about traffic penalties or reviewing court documents, typically need fewer hours and fall at the lower end of costs. Moderately complex matters involving plea negotiations or preparation for magistrates' court appearances sit in the mid-range, whilst serious criminal charges requiring extensive preparation, witness interviews, and multiple court appearances demand significantly more time and reach the higher cost bracket.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Criminal & Traffic lawyer in Chullora, NSW?
Criminal matters often involve specific paperwork, so it can help to have photo identification, any court documents or charge sheets you've received, and police statements if available. Traffic offences may require your driver's licence details and any infringement notices. If you're dealing with bail conditions, those documents could also be useful for your lawyer's review.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ation. Some Australia Post offices offer services like certified copies, photo ID, or printing.
